#542980 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#542980 is composed of 32.9% red, 16.1% green and 50.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 34.4% cyan, 68% magenta, 0% yellow and 49.8% black. It has a hue angle of 269.7 degrees, a saturation of 51.5% and a lightness of 33.1%. #542980 color hex could be obtained by blending #a852ff with #000001. Closest websafe color is: #663399.

● #542980 color description : Dark moderate violet.
#542980 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#542980 has RGB values of R:84, G:41, B:128 and CMYK values of C:0.34, M:0.68, Y:0, K:0.5. Its decimal value is 5515648.
